Hi! I’m Ron Davis & I’m running to represent District 46 in the State House.

My mom and dad were teenagers when they found out they were pregnant with me. They were scared, but they had something too many families are missing now: a real shot.

Housing was affordable. My dad got a factory job with good overtime. They were able to build a stable life and give my sister and me opportunities they never had.

That story is personal to me, but it is also political.

Because if housing and childcare had cost then what they cost now, my family would not have made it. And I know a lot of people in our community feel that same pressure today.

People are working hard, doing everything right, and still wondering whether they or their kids will be able to stay here.

That is what pushed me to run.

It shouldn’t be this hard to build a stable life Northeast Seattle.

People are feeling the pressure because the system keeps delivering the same result higher costs, less stability, fewer paths forward.

That doesn’t change on its own. It changes when we’re willing to rethink how we build housing, how we tax, and how public services function in practice.

That is why Ron’s priorities include:

  • Building enough homes so housing costs come down

  • Freezing rent in publicly owned housing

  • Making childcare affordable for every family

  • Investing in reliable public transportation

  • Fully funding public education

  • Defending civil rights and democratic freedoms

  • and more
